The Joint Entrance Examination (JEE) Main is the gateway for admission into prestigious engineering institutions across India. For the 2021 academic year, the National Testing Agency (NTA) maintained a comprehensive syllabus covering Physics, Chemistry, and Mathematics. Understanding this syllabus is crucial for candidates aiming to build a strong foundation for both JEE Main and Advanced.
Physics Syllabus
The Physics section in 2021 was designed to test the conceptual understanding and application of physical laws. Key topics included:
- Physics and Measurement: Units, dimensions, and error analysis.
- Kinematics and Laws of Motion: Projectile motion, friction, and Newton's laws.
- Work, Energy, and Power: Conservation laws and collisions.
- Rotational Motion: Center of mass and moment of inertia.
- Gravitation and Properties of Solids/Fluids: Universal law, elasticity, and Bernoulli's theorem.
- Thermodynamics and Kinetic Theory of Gases: Heat transfer and ideal gas behavior.
- Oscillations and Waves: SHM, string waves, and Doppler effect.
- Electrostatics and Current Electricity: Capacitors, Ohm's law, and Kirchhoff's laws.
- Magnetic Effects of Current and Magnetism: Biot-Savart law and moving coils.
- Electromagnetic Induction and Alternating Currents: Faraday's law and LCR circuits.
- Optics: Reflection, refraction, and wave optics.
- Dual Nature of Matter and Atoms/Nuclei: Photoelectric effect and radioactivity.
- Electronic Devices and Communication Systems: Diodes, transistors, and signal propagation.
Chemistry Syllabus
Chemistry was divided into Physical, Organic, and Inorganic branches. The syllabus focused on core principles and reactive behaviors:
- Physical Chemistry: Basic concepts, states of matter, atomic structure, chemical bonding, chemical thermodynamics, equilibrium, redox reactions, chemical kinetics, and surface chemistry.
- Inorganic Chemistry: Classification of elements, periodic properties, general principles of metal isolation, hydrogen, s-block, p-block, d-block, and f-block elements, coordination compounds, and environmental chemistry.
- Organic Chemistry: Purification and characterization of compounds, hydrocarbons, organic compounds containing halogens, oxygen, nitrogen, polymers, and biomolecules. Chemistry in everyday life was also a significant component.
Mathematics Syllabus
The Mathematics section tested logical reasoning, analytical skills, and mathematical computation. Essential chapters included:
- Sets, Relations, and Functions: Cartesian product, domains, and types of functions.
- Complex Numbers and Quadratic Equations: De Moivre's theorem and root properties.
- Matrices and Determinants: Operations, inverse, and solving linear equations.
- Permutations and Combinations: Fundamental principles and applications.
- Binomial Theorem and Sequences/Series: Arithmetic, Geometric, and Harmonic progressions.
- Limit, Continuity, and Differentiability: Calculus fundamentals, derivatives, and applications.
- Integral Calculus: Indefinite, definite, and area under the curve.
- Differential Equations: First-order and first-degree equations.
- Coordinate Geometry: Straight lines, circles, parabolas, ellipses, and hyperbolas.
- Three-Dimensional Geometry: Direction cosines, lines, and planes.
- Vector Algebra and Statistics/Probability: Scalar/vector products and distributions.
- Trigonometry: Identities and equations.
Preparation Strategy
For the 2021 exam, successful students prioritized NCERT textbooks as the primary source, followed by extensive problem-solving practice from previous years' question papers. Time management was highlighted as a critical factor, given the distribution of questions across the three subjects. Consistent revision of formulas and chemical reactions proved to be the differentiator for top scorers.
